• Collection ID SDN-065687E
  • Creator Names Chicago Daily News, Inc., photographer.
  • Title [African American Boxer, Jack Johnson standing on the steps in front of the Joliet county jail] [graphic].
  • Dates [1925]
  • Physical description 1 negative : b&w, glass ; 4 x 5 in.
  • Access and usage restrictions Restriction: Original negatives are fragile and not available to researchers. Please consult the on-line image instead.
  • Collection summary Informal portrait of African American pugilist Jack Johnson standing on the steps in front of the Joliet county jail in Joliet, Illinois, dark exposure, wearing a suit. A crowd is standing in the background.
